Transaction 7518484e444eb3d13dc111a9b12d15068aa2108c193d7495e04ee110edfd3e3b

1 Input
2 Outputs
  • 7518484e444eb3d13dc111a9b12d15068aa2108c193d7495e04ee110edfd3e3b:0
  • value  1475788
    address  2NFuUDWFAmQhEoTH6Yh8uwXhch8fnKuXu2Q
  • 7518484e444eb3d13dc111a9b12d15068aa2108c193d7495e04ee110edfd3e3b:1
  • value  8777444831
    address  2MuvSAW6KACg2qRU8aBEkhBbkcKiLvMYvxp